Product Description

Acriflavine Hydrochloride (Hcl) is a chemical compound belonging to the class of acridine compounds. It is usually found as a yellow to orange crystalline powder with applications mainly in infection control and sometimes as a dye in laboratory procedures. It is used for different applications in medicine, biology, and research. The chemical compound belongs to the group of compounds known as acriflavine, which is a well-known antiseptic and antimicrobial agent. It is soluble in water, ethanol, and some organic solvents. It can be used very well in either aqueous or alcoholic formulation. Acriflavine Hydrochloride (Hcl) is an antiseptic, antimicrobial, and dyeing versatile chemical.
